Our Strategic Land Team are looking to recruit a Strategic Land Manager for our Central Region (covering the divisions of West Midlands, East Midlands, South Midlands, Northern Home Counties and Eastern Counties). The Role The role of Strategic Land Manager is responsible for identifying, negotiating and acquiring strategic residential sites. The Strategic Land Manager also manages the land tasks on sites through the duration of their promotion, working closely with planners within the team and also the consultants. The role of Strategic Land Manager reports to the Strategic Land Director Central and Group Strategic Land Director. Principle accountabilities of the Strategic Land Manager role include: Identify future strategic sites with development potential in line with the acquisition strategy agreed with the Strategic Land Director. Conduct planning and viability appraisals and searches for sites to assess their suitability for acquisition. Once sites are identified as having positive planning status contact landowners and agents alike in order to promote Bellway as their preferred choice of developer/promoter. Must be proactive on liaising with agents and ensuring opportunities are coming into the business, in liaison with the Strategic Land Director Being an active part of the bidding process for new sites, including preparing submissions, attending interviews etc and working with the Strategic Land team. Successfully negotiate heads of terms with landowners and agents, then assist with the management of the legals process Working with planning input, prepare planning strategies, working with others, that aim to obtain a Local Plan allocation or planning permission in shortest possible timeframe in liaison with the relevant Strategic Land Director. Be involved in the project management of the planning promotion process of each site in line with the agreed planning strategy liaising closely with landowners and their agents. From time to time attend planning committee meetings and public consultation events in order to present on behalf of Bellway as necessary, often outside of normal working hours.
